Iranian authorities hanged a woman in public in the north-western province of East Azerbaijan, state media reported on Sunday.

The unnamed woman was hanged in public in the provincial capital Tabriz, the daily Tehran-e Emrouz wrote. The report put her age at 29.

She was accused of murder and conspiring to kill.

The newspaper said the woman had strangled her husband while he slept. The same night her two male accomplices, who were paid 1 billion rials ($108,000), strangled her husband’s parents and stabbed his brother to death, it added.

“She had serious problems with her husband and hated his family. She hired Farhad and Reza to kill her brother-in-law and his parents,” an unnamed judiciary official told the paper.

The case attracted great public interest and about 5,000 people, including judiciary and police officials, gathered to watch the hangings.

Murder, rape, adultery, armed robbery, apostasy and drug trafficking are all punishable by death under Iran’s Islamic Sharia law, imposed since the 1979 Islamic revolution.
